Prop Firm DrawDown Protector : Prop Firm Capital Protection Expert MT5 |Forex Money Management: Forex Trade Management Expert MT5 | ICT Concepts Indicator MT5 |Smart Money Concepts Expert MT5 | Smart Money Trap Scanner | Get a free Expert Advisor license via Telegram and WhatsApp
Understanding Automated Trading
Automated trading refers to the execution of trades based on pre-established rules, removing the need for continuous human intervention. These rules can include:
- Technical Indicators: Using tools such as Moving Averages or RSI to identify potential trade opportunities.
- Volume Analysis: Monitoring trading volumes to evaluate market activity.
- Market Conditions: Establishing price thresholds or volatility levels that trigger automatic trades.
This method ensures rapid execution, reduces human error, and allows simultaneous management of multiple strategies across different markets.
Levels of Automated Trading
Automated trading systems can generally be classified into three levels:
- Basic Level: Implements simple conditional orders, such as Stop Loss and Take Profit.
- Semi-Automatic Level: Combines human analysis with automated scripts or bots.
- Advanced Level: Uses complex algorithms, artificial intelligence, and machine learning for both trade decisions and execution.
Understanding these levels helps traders select systems that align with their objectives and risk tolerance.
Automated vs. Algorithmic Trading
Although the terms are sometimes used interchangeably, automated and algorithmic trading are distinct:
- Automated Trading: Focuses on executing trades based on predefined rules and does not always require extensive market analysis.
- Algorithmic Trading: Employs sophisticated mathematical models to analyze market data and generate trading signals.
In essence, all algorithmic trading is automated, but not all automated trading qualifies as algorithmic.
Common Automated Trading Strategies
Traders employ various strategies in automated trading, including:
- Scalping: Engaging in frequent, short-term trades to capture small price movements.
- Trend Following: Trading in alignment with prevailing market trends.
- Arbitrage: Exploiting price differences between markets or instruments.
- Averaging: Gradually building positions to manage risk exposure.
- Conditional Trading: Executing trades only under specific market conditions.
Choosing the right strategy depends on market dynamics and individual trading goals.
Advantages of Automated Trading
Key benefits of automated trading include:
- Rapid Execution: Orders are executed faster, which is critical in volatile markets.
- Emotion-Free Trading: Reduces the impact of fear, greed, and other psychological biases.
- Backtesting Capabilities: Strategies can be tested against historical data before live deployment.
- Continuous Market Monitoring: The system can track markets 24/7 without fatigue.
These advantages support disciplined and efficient trading practices.
Risks and Limitations
Automated trading also has inherent risks:
- Technical Dependence: Requires reliable hardware and stable internet connectivity.
- System Failures: Software glitches or malfunctions can disrupt trading.
- Market Adaptability: Systems may struggle to respond to sudden, unexpected events.
- Over-Optimization: Strategies that are too closely fitted to historical data may fail in real-world conditions.
Implementing strong risk management protocols is essential to mitigate these issues.
The Role of Trading Psychology
While automated systems reduce emotional involvement in trade execution, the trader’s psychology still affects system design and optimization. Ensuring strategies are logic-driven and well-tested is critical to prevent automating flawed decision-making.
Platforms and Tools
Several platforms support automated trading:
- MetaTrader 4/5: Widely used platforms that support Expert Advisors (EAs).
- TradingView: Provides scripting tools for creating and testing strategies.
- NinjaTrader: Offers advanced charting and automation features.
Choosing the right platform depends on the trader’s skill level, strategy complexity, and technical requirements.
Artificial Intelligence in Trading
Integrating artificial intelligence (AI) into automated trading enhances data analysis capabilities and adaptability to changing market conditions. AI can optimize strategies, improve decision-making, and provide predictive insights for more informed trading.
Effective Execution and Risk Management
Successful automated trading requires:
- Comprehensive Backtesting: Evaluating strategies using historical data to assess reliability.
- Real-Time Monitoring: Observing system performance to detect anomalies quickly.
- Risk Controls: Setting appropriate stop-loss levels and position sizes to safeguard capital.
Neglecting these steps can result in significant losses, even with well-designed systems.
Conclusion
Automated trading addresses core challenges in Forex and other financial markets, including speed, accuracy, and emotional bias. By leveraging predefined logic and advanced technologies, traders can improve efficiency and consistency. However, understanding system mechanics, practicing sound risk management, and continuously monitoring performance are essential for achieving long-term success.